Levitt Pavilion Denver is a non-profit established with the purpose of building community through music. We believe in embracing the local, including the musicians, architects, construction company, staff, artists and sponsors. Levitt Pavilion Denver is more than just another music venue – it is a nexus for local non-profits and arts groups across the Rocky Mountain region. When complete in 2017, Levitt Pavilion Denver will feature: - 50 free concerts annually with local, regional, national and international acts - A rich spectrum of music genres: R&B, country, rock, Latin, blues, jazz, children’s and more! - Relaxed, open lawn setting - Local food vendors - State-of-the-art sound and lighting - Easily accessible location near public transportation and bike paths - Family-friendly environment Outside of Levitt Pavilion Denver concert series, the state-of-the-art amphitheater will be available programmed to include schools, arts organizations, outside promoters, and other non-profits.

Studio 52 is a community artist space located in the heart of Allston, MA. Our facility is an inspiring, clean, and positive environment for artists and musicians to perfect their craft. We are extremely excited to be contributing such an impressive space for artists to release their creativity and are proud to support the Boston music scene and local artist community. Studio 52 is run by artists, for artists.
